The Gold Experience, released in 1995, was recorded primarily at Paisley Park Studios in Minneapolis, Prince's own state-of-the-art facility, with additional sessions at other locations. Prince served as the primary producer and engineer on the album, maintaining creative control over most of the material while collaborating with various musicians and producers including Tony Thompson and others. The album was notable for its use of live instrumentation combined with electronic production, reflecting Prince's diverse musical influences across funk, rock, and R&B styles. Recording took place during 1994-1995 as Prince was navigating his complex relationship with Warner Bros. Records, which contextually influenced the album's development and release strategy. The project showcased Prince's technical proficiency in multiple instruments and his characteristic approach to layering vocals and instrumentation in the studio.
